  1. Fights Malaria and Dengue Fever

In some regions, papaya leaves have been traditionally used as a treatment for malaria and dengue fever. Studies have shown that papaya leaf extract can help increase platelet count, making it especially beneficial for those suffering from dengue fever, which often leads to a dangerous drop in platelets. The antiviral and anti-inflammatory properties of papaya leaves may help to alleviate symptoms and promote faster recovery from these illnesses.

How to Boil Papaya Leaves

Making papaya leaf tea is incredibly simple and only requires a few ingredients:

Ingredients:

  • Fresh papaya leaves (1-2 leaves)
  • 2 cups of water
  • Optional: Honey or lemon for flavor

Directions:

  1. Wash the papaya leaves thoroughly to remove any dirt or contaminants.
  2. Boil 2 cups of water in a pot.
  3. Add the papaya leaves to the boiling water.
  4. Let it simmer for 5-10 minutes, depending on how strong you want the tea.
  5. Remove the leaves and strain the liquid.
  6. Optionally, add honey or lemon for sweetness and flavor.

Note: You can consume 1-2 cups of this tea per day to reap the health benefits.
